MailArmor: A java-based spam solution
By ron carlson, Insanely Great Mac
June 24th 2002

Finally a single app to clean up spam on multiple platforms

MailArmor is an application that helps to keep users inbox free of unsolicited e-mail, 
better known as spam: it inspects before it leaves the mail server, and lets the 
legitimate messages pass through undisturbed, while leaving suspect messages on the 
server to be reexamined later or just deleted. It works as an email proxy, with 
support for POP and IMAP, that makes it independent from the e-mail client. As it has 
been developed in Java, it is also independent from the operating system or platform. 
         
This application is freeware and is available for download now.
